Skip to content

varnitsaxena7/Talkie

Repository files navigation

Talkie - Dynamic ChatApp

Welcome to Talkie, a dynamic MERN-based ChatApp designed to enhance connections through seamless communication.

Overview

Talkie leverages MongoDB, Express.js, React, and Node.js to provide an intuitive platform for engaging and seamless communication. It offers innovative features and a user-friendly interface that fosters connections among users.

Key Features

  • Real-time Chat: Engage in real-time conversations with other users.
  • User Authentication: Secure user authentication and authorization.
  • Responsive Design: Access Talkie on any device — desktop, tablet, or smartphone.
  • Intuitive Interface: Easy-to-use interface for a smooth user experience.

Demo

Check out the live demo: Talkie Demo

Technologies Used

  • MongoDB
  • Express.js
  • React
  • Node.js

Getting Started

To run Talkie locally:

  1. Clone this repository: git clone https://github.com/varnitsaxena7/Talkie.git

  2. Navigate to the project directory at first the client frontend directory.

  3. Install dependencies: npm install

  4. Start the development server: npm start

  5. Open your browser and visit: http://localhost:3000

  6. Now navigate to the backend directory.

  7. Install dependencies: npm install

8.Run: nodemon index.js

9.Now you can use the application.

Usage

  • Register and login to start chatting with other users.
  • Create new chat rooms or join existing ones.
  • Enjoy seamless communication with real-time messaging.

Developed By

This project was developed by Varnit Saxena.